The actors are very professional and the story is certainly attractive. I usually prefer scifi genres but this story certainly got my attention.
What I really point out is that the cast is very unique for an Asian Drama. Popular Chinese and Korean dramas usually prefer young(18-25) girls, pale-skinned, thin, actresses full of plastic surgery. Light the Night chose middle aged ladies, some with plastic surgery, but not all of them. And not all in the usually body type, the character Aiko is even a bit chubby and has a typical southern China skin-tone. There is an old lady playing in that night-club. They are certainly very mature in the acting and have a lot of experience and in fact it wouldn't play well with younger actress.
One tiny problem I'd point out is the confusing chronology. I don't know if it's netflix messing up or what, but show doesn't really explain in which point in time they are before the incident, which makes me confused about when the story is at the moment. But, it is not a big deal and won't make your experience bad because of it.
I strongly recommend it and I also suggest to ignore very low ratings of this show, as it is usually a bunch of Mainlanders complaining because the show is taiwanese. I'm looking forward for season 2.

As a non-Asian drama lover, I think Light the Night showcased a different take on Asian dramas. The typical over dramatic, lovey dovey romance was not on display here. Light the Night displayed what the working women endured in the 80s and I found it interesting. Story was good. Overall very decent drama from the Taiwan.
Wonderful actors and character building is great. Don't listen to the mainland China reviewers. They don't like anything that is good that comes out of Taiwan including this show.
The acting from the six leading ladies is how you would portray women in movies. Definitely great acting chops and a joy to watch all 8 episodes in a row.
The chemistry of each character is great and casting is superb. I just hope season 2 on December 30, 2021 will introduce even more character developments.

I personally like the portrayal of emotions here, it's not common, I like the characters, you can see their flaws, their strengths too. I'm not familiar with taiwanese art or media but the actors are good especially the female leads. It's slow burn, take your time, you'll find emotions you'll relate to and not the pretty kind.
It is probably the most powerful casts I have ever seen in a Taiwan drama. The casts are most talented and be part of a leading role in many drama or movie in Taiwan. Even eating a meal in restaurant can see full of emotion and deep deep acting. The story just like a recent drama white lotus but doesn't matter like or not, just a crime theme but I really addicted to the acting. The background in 80s is a big bonus for those live and grow up in that time and city. Don't surprise lots of awards will go this drama, no doubt Ruby Lin another peak in her acting career, really have progress compare her "16 summer" and the improvement is huge. For whom like watch acting, please watch this.
